About this property

Angel Hotel

Angel Hotel puts you within a 10-minute drive of Surrey Hills. You can relax with a drink at the bar/lounge, and the coffee shop/cafe is the perfect spot to grab a bite to eat. The helpful staff and location get great marks from fellow travelers.

Fabulous room, we had a suite in the old part of the hotel. There was a separate sitting room, large bedroom with superking four poster. The bathroom was beautiful and very well designed. The room was warm and comfortable. The hotel is situated in central Guildford and it is easy to walk to most venues in the town. The only downside is that the hotel has no parking and although you can park on the street in the evening there is no access during the day for unloading/loading luggage.
